Strategic Profile

The company's RAMP platform is a proprietary AI and machine learning engine designed to analyze billions of consumer signals in real-time to efficiently acquire traffic across various search engines and social media channels and monetize it through its network of digital properties. System1 operates a portfolio of digital brands including MapQuest, Startpage, Info.com and HowStuffWorks that provide steady first-party data, reducing reliance on third-party cookies.

Cyborg Score Rationale

The company does not have a meaningful market cap at $35M and faces delisting risks as a micro-cap that must maintain minimum bid price thresholds, though System1 is currently an active NYSE listing. SST significantly underperformed both its industry and the broader market over the past year.
